HP Smart Tank 651

Hello,

 

 I have a Smart Tank 651 Printer which I bought for Christmas cards 1 year ago exactly. This year, the print is faded, and there are lines in the pictures. I have aligned, cleaned, done all I can to try and resolve this.

Dragon-Fur was on to something, after all. My black ink was nearly empty, and all three color ink tanks were still nearly 3/4 full. This got me thinking that I may not have been printing enough items in color to keep the printer head "unclogged". I ordered a new tri-color printer head, and all is well.
